Where is the warmest place in Arizona in the winter?

Yuma
Yuma is Arizona’s warmest winter city and the sunniest year round place in the US, with an annual average of 4,133 hours of sunshine. Yuma has a classic low desert climate with extremely low relative humidity and very high summer temperatures.

Where do snowbirds go in the winter in Arizona?

The majority of snowbirds settle in golf and condominium communities, mobile home communities and RV parks around the Phoenix area. Most winter visitors stay in the Western side of Arizona, where daytime temperatures are normally in the 20C range.

Does Arizona get snow?

Does it snow in Arizona? Absolutely. In fact the amount may surprise you – upwards of 75 inches each year in the northern regions, and at the ski resorts (yes, they have ski resorts in Arizona), the total is 260 inches, an impressive 21.5 feet.The weather in Arizona is all about altitude.

What is winter like in Phoenix AZ?

Winter Weather in Phoenix
Temperatures are mild during the winter in Phoenix. The area has average highs of 68°F to 76°F (20°C to 24.4°C) from November to February and average lows from 44°F to 51°F (6.7°C to 10.6°C). Rainfall is minimal, and there’s generally an inch or less on average every month.

How warm is Scottsdale in February?

Daily high temperatures increase by 5°F, from 68°F to 73°F, rarely falling below 59°F or exceeding 82°F. Daily low temperatures increase by 4°F, from 46°F to 50°F, rarely falling below 39°F or exceeding 57°F.
